Understanding Skin Types
Understanding skin types is crucial when it comes to choosing the right eyebrow tattoo technique. Your skin type plays a significant role in how well the tattoo will heal, retain color, and ultimately look. There are generally four main skin types: normal, dry, oily, and combination. Each type requires specific considerations to ensure the best results.

Normal skin types usually have balanced moisture levels and aren’t prone to excessive oiliness or dryness. For individuals with normal skin, most eyebrow tattoo techniques can work effectively.

Dry skin tends to lack moisture and may be prone to flakiness. It’s essential to choose a technique that won’t exacerbate dryness and will provide long-lasting results.

Oily skin types produce more sebum, making it challenging for the pigment to stay in place. Techniques that cater to oily skin, such as microblading, can help achieve better retention and a more natural appearance.

Combination skin has areas that are both oily and dry, requiring a tailored approach for each section. Understanding your skin type will guide you in selecting the most suitable eyebrow tattoo technique for optimal results.

Microblading for Oily Skin
When dealing with oily skin, microblading emerges as a preferred technique for achieving long-lasting and natural-looking eyebrow tattoos. Oily skin can often cause traditional eyebrow makeup to smudge or fade quickly, making it challenging to maintain well-defined brows throughout the day.

Microblading, a semi-permanent tattooing method, is an excellent solution for those with oily skin looking for a more enduring eyebrow enhancement option.

Microblading involves using a handheld tool to create small, hair-like strokes in the brow area, mimicking the appearance of natural hair. This technique deposits pigment into the superficial layers of the skin, resulting in eyebrows that look fuller and more defined.

For individuals with oily skin, the fine strokes from microblading tend to hold up better compared to traditional makeup, providing a long-lasting and smudge-proof solution.

If you have oily skin, opting for microblading can offer you well-defined and hassle-free eyebrows that require minimal daily maintenance. The results can last anywhere from one to three years, making it a convenient choice for those looking to enhance their eyebrows without the need for frequent touch-ups.

Powder Brows for Dry Skin
For dry skin types, Powder Brows present a suitable alternative to achieve well-defined eyebrows that complement your skin’s characteristics. Unlike microblading, which may not hold well on drier skin, Powder Brows can be a better option due to their softer appearance and ability to blend seamlessly with your skin texture.

The Powder Brow technique involves creating a shaded effect that mimics the look of filled-in brows or a soft makeup finish. This method is ideal for those with dry skin as it doesn’t require precise hair-like strokes, which mightn’t show up as clearly on drier skin types.

Powder Brows offer a more subtle and natural-looking result, making them a great choice for individuals with dry skin who desire a fuller brow appearance without a harsh or overly defined look. The soft shading technique used in Powder Brows can help enhance the overall shape and fullness of your eyebrows while maintaining a softer, more diffused finish that complements dry skin’s characteristics.

Combination Skin Solutions
Navigating eyebrow tattoo techniques can be particularly challenging for those with combination skin. This skin type presents a unique set of challenges due to having both oily and dry areas on the face.

When it comes to choosing the right eyebrow tattoo technique for combination skin, it’s important to strike a balance. Opting for microblading can be a great choice as it creates natural hair-like strokes, enhancing sparse areas while maintaining a soft look. The semi-permanent nature of microblading also allows for adjustments to be made as needed to accommodate the varying skin conditions.

Another suitable option for combination skin is the ombre technique. Ombre brows offer a soft, powdery finish that’s gentle on the skin and works well to fill in sparse areas without appearing too harsh. This technique can help blend the different skin textures seamlessly, providing a polished and natural-looking result.

When considering eyebrow tattoo techniques for combination skin, consulting with a skilled technician is key to achieving the perfect balance of color and texture for a flawless finish.

Sensitive Skin Considerations
Curious about how to address sensitive skin when it comes to eyebrow tattoo techniques? Sensitive skin requires special attention to avoid any adverse reactions during and after the procedure. It’s crucial to choose a skilled and experienced tattoo artist who understands the nuances of working with sensitive skin. Additionally, conducting a patch test before the full procedure can help determine if any allergic reactions might occur.

Here’s a table highlighting key considerations for sensitive skin during eyebrow tattooing:

Consideration Description Importance
Skin Patch Test Test for allergic reactions beforehand High
Gentle Pigments Use hypoallergenic pigments Medium
Minimal Trauma Gentle technique to avoid skin irritation High
Post-Care Instructions Provide detailed aftercare guidelines Medium
Follow-Up Appointments Monitor for any adverse reactions High
